Written Answers. - Air Corps Helicopters.

251.

asked the Minister for Defence the number of helicopters in the possession of the Air Corps at present, including those which have a facility to fly at night; if he will indicate the number of times in the last two years they have been used at night; and if he will outline specifically whether their use has been for military, civilian or rescue services or otherwise.

Limerick West): At present the Air Corps operates eight Alouette, two Gazelle and five Dauphin helicopters.

The Dauphin aircraft are equipped for night flying. Because of the demanding requirements of night flying, night operations have not yet been undertaken. However, intensive training for such operations is continuing and is expected to be completed in 1988.
